Output 4d90d230335eafed8d2ef080cc1dce25aacdddedbd10b0cf758cf80b19dbe636:4

value
266368
script pubkey
OP_0 OP_PUSHBYTES_20 3dbd07cdbbd560d8d46caef5aa6cb4d8ac2760e1
address
bc1q8k7s0ndm64sd34rv4m665m95mzkzwc8p8lclr8
transaction
4d90d230335eafed8d2ef080cc1dce25aacdddedbd10b0cf758cf80b19dbe636
confirmations
153171
spent
true